Boston Mutual Life Insurance Welcomes a New Leader
In a significant leadership change, Boston Mutual Life Insurance Company has officially appointed Grant D. Ward Sr., JD, as its new Chief Executive Officer and President, effective January 1, 2026. This transition marks the start of a new chapter for the company, which has been a provider of insurance solutions for many individuals and workplaces across the nation.
Ward steps into this pivotal role as Paul A. Quaranto Jr. prepares for retirement after years of dedicated service. Quaranto’s final day will be December 31, 2025, when he will also step down as President of Life Insurance Company of Boston New York (LICOBNY), a subsidiary of Boston Mutual.
A Trusted Experienced Leader
Having been part of Boston Mutual’s leadership team since 2016, Ward possesses extensive knowledge of the company's operations. Prior to his new role, he held the position of President and Chief Operating Officer (COO) and previously served as General Counsel and Secretary. His deep understanding of customer experience, claims, legal matters, compliance, and facilities management equips him well to lead the company into its next phase.

Ward’s career before joining Boston Mutual includes notable roles in organizations such as SBLI of Massachusetts, MetLife Financial Services, Deloitte, and even the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ission.
Active in Leadership and Community Service
In addition to his professional accomplishments, Ward is actively involved in various industry organizations, representing Boston Mutual Life at the American Council of Life Insurers (ACLI) and the Life Insurance Association of Massachusetts (LIAM). His commitment extends beyond corporate duties, as he engages with community initiatives such as mentoring young individuals through Big Brothers Big Sisters of Eastern Massachusetts and volunteering for various causes, including Conexion and My Brother's Keeper in Easton, MA.
About Boston Mutual Life Insurance Company
Founded in 1891, Boston Mutual Life Insurance Company is a well-regarded mutual carrier focused on providing insurance solutions to working Americans and their families. The company's headquarters are located in Canton, Massachusetts, with another office in Omaha, Nebraska.
